What is swimming pool accidents law in Virginia

Swimming pool accidents law in Virginia addresses injuries occurring in pool settings. This area covers premises liability where property owners must ensure safe conditions. Law Offices Of SRIS, P.C. has locations in Fairfax, Virginia. Legal standards require proper fencing, supervision, and maintenance. When accidents happen, determining fault involves examining safety measures and owner responsibilities.

Swimming pool accidents law in Virginia focuses on premises liability and safety standards for pool owners. Property owners have legal duties to maintain safe swimming environments. This includes installing proper barriers, providing adequate supervision, and ensuring equipment functions correctly. Virginia statutes establish requirements for pool fencing and safety measures.

When accidents occur, the legal process involves investigating the circumstances. Documentation of the incident, witness statements, and safety inspections are important. Evidence collection helps establish whether safety standards were met. Medical records document injuries sustained in the accident.

Defense options for property owners include demonstrating compliance with safety regulations. Showing proper maintenance records and supervision logs can support a defense. Insurance coverage may apply to pool accident claims. Legal strategies address liability questions and potential compensation.

Professional insight considers Virginia’s specific legal standards for pool safety. Understanding local ordinances and state regulations is vital. Legal professionals evaluate whether safety measures met required standards. This analysis informs case strategy and potential outcomes.

Virginia law requires pool owners to maintain safe environments. Failure to meet safety standards can lead to legal responsibility for injuries.

How to handle swimming pool accident claims in Virginia

Handling swimming pool accident claims in Virginia involves specific legal steps. First, document the incident scene and gather evidence. Law Offices Of SRIS, P.C. has locations in Fairfax, Virginia. Medical attention should be immediate to address injuries. Contacting a pool accident attorney Virginia helps handle the claims process. Timely action preserves evidence and meets legal deadlines.

Handling swimming pool accident claims requires understanding Virginia’s legal procedures. The first step involves immediate medical attention for injuries. Documenting the accident scene through photographs and notes preserves evidence. Witness contact information should be collected promptly.

Legal action begins with determining liability under Virginia premises liability law. Property owners must maintain safe pool areas. Evidence of safety violations strengthens claims. Documentation includes maintenance records, inspection reports, and safety equipment status.

The claims process involves notifying responsible parties and insurance companies. Virginia has specific deadlines for personal injury claims. Missing these deadlines can prevent recovery. Legal professionals help manage communication with insurers and other parties.

Defense considerations include evaluating comparative negligence in Virginia. If injured parties contributed to accidents, compensation may be reduced. Legal strategies address these factors while pursuing fair outcomes. Settlement negotiations or litigation may follow investigation.

Professional guidance ensures proper case management. Attorneys evaluate evidence strength and liability questions. They help calculate appropriate compensation for medical costs and other losses. Legal representation protects rights throughout the process.

Proper documentation and timely legal action are essential for pool accident claims. Virginia’s legal deadlines require prompt attention to preserve rights.

Can I pursue compensation for drowning accidents in Virginia

Compensation for drowning accidents in Virginia depends on establishing negligence. A Virginia drowning accident lawyer evaluates whether safety standards were violated. Law Offices Of SRIS, P.C. has locations in Fairfax, Virginia. Evidence must show the property owner failed to provide adequate safety measures. Legal claims can address medical expenses, lost income, and other damages resulting from drowning incidents.

Pursuing compensation for drowning accidents involves Virginia’s negligence laws. Property owners must maintain safe pool environments with proper supervision and barriers. When drowning occurs, investigation determines whether safety standards were met. Evidence includes pool maintenance records, supervision logs, and safety equipment status.

Legal claims require establishing the property owner’s breach of duty. This involves showing failure to install required fencing, provide adequate supervision, or maintain safe conditions. Virginia’s premises liability standards apply to residential and commercial pools. Documentation of safety violations strengthens compensation claims.

Compensation can address various damages including medical expenses, rehabilitation costs, and lost income. In tragic cases, wrongful death claims may apply. Virginia law allows recovery for both economic and non-economic losses. Calculating appropriate compensation considers current and future needs.

Defense aspects involve evaluating whether the property owner met legal standards. Insurance coverage questions may arise in drowning cases. Legal strategies address liability determinations and potential defenses. Settlement negotiations or court proceedings follow evidence evaluation.

Professional assessment considers Virginia’s specific legal requirements for pool safety. Understanding local ordinances and state regulations informs case strategy. Legal guidance helps handle the involved process of drowning accident claims.

Virginia allows compensation for drowning accidents when negligence is proven. Proper evidence collection and legal guidance are important for these cases.
